Body

Authorship and Creation

The Phosphorescent Blues was performed by Punch Brothers[7]. It was produced by T Bone Burnett[6].

Publication

The Phosphorescent Blues was published on January 27, 2015[10]. Its language of work or name is recorded as English[9]. Its genre is bluegrass music[4].

Adaptations and Inspiration

The Phosphorescent Blues followed Who's Feeling Young Now?[5].
